It seems that management of the out of time pileup is necesarry and it's mode should be set to 'Poisson':
process.mix.input.OOT_type = cms.untracked.string('Poisson') process.mix.input.manage_OOT = cms.untracked.bool(True)
OscarMTMasterThread::stopThread() has not been called to stop Geant4 and join the master thread terminate called without an active exceptionThis is an useless error message. It is known to occur when the probability function used to generate the pileup distribution is not properly normalized. A guess for what it might mean: The mixingmodule starts children processes to generate a given number of one-pileup events at the same time for having them mixed later. Whenever it requires no more pileups mixed, it stops waiting for its children processes and it might cause some kind of error.
